Output de81fabfaabae3df4ea27f32645dfe13162b8f00a1dae41aee9141468600f526:0

value
31081934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d37c21e14880fb8cfeb9cc1b0520e2d2a9727e54 OP_EQUAL
address
3LyFCtNBXzZ3qN7VTCxr7CBphMwkiFTVQs
transaction
de81fabfaabae3df4ea27f32645dfe13162b8f00a1dae41aee9141468600f526
spent
true